STUDENT PROFILE
Total undergraduates: 31,514
Full-time undergraduates: 29,799
Part-time undergraduates: 1,715
Total graduate students: 9,852
Full-time graduate students: 7,476
Part-time graduate students: 2,376
Degree seeking undergraduate student breakdown:
0.1% American Indian or Alaskan Native
12.8% Asian, non-Hispanic/Latino
6.0% Black or African American, non-Hispanic/Latino
7.6% Hispanic/Latino
0.1% Native Hawaiian or other Pacific Islander, non-Hispanic/Latino
67.0% White, non-Hispanic/Latino
4.2% Two or more races non-Hispanic/Latino
1.0% Nonresident Alien
1.2% Race and/or Ethnicity unknown

CAMPUS ENVIRONMENT
Campus size: 767 acres
Nearest major city: Atlanta

LIVING ON CAMPUS
Institution offers housing: yes
Housing types (% in housing type, if given):
  • coed dorms
  • women's dorms
  • special housing for disabled students
Percent of freshmen who live in school housing: 99%
Percent of students who live in school housing: 35%
Percent of students who live off campus: 65%
